summaryrefslogtreecommitdiff
path: root/db/range_del_aggregator.cc
AgeCommit message (Expand)Author
2019-04-18Make ReadRangeDelAggregator::ShouldDelete() more inline friendly (#5202)Siying Dong
2018-12-19Remove stale TODO (#4800)Abhishek Madan
2018-12-18Fix unused member compile errorAbhishek Madan
2018-12-17Remove v1 RangeDelAggregator (#4778)Abhishek Madan
2018-10-24Fix two contrun job failures (#4587)Zhongyi Xie
2018-10-17Lazily initialize RangeDelAggregator stripe map entries (#4497)Abhishek Madan
2018-10-11Use vector in UncollapsedRangeDelMap (#4487)Abhishek Madan
2018-10-10Update HISTORY.md, fix unity_test failure (#4479)Abhishek Madan
2018-10-09Truncate range tombstones by leveraging InternalKeys (#4432)Abhishek Madan
2018-09-25Handle tombstones at the same seqno in the CollapsedRangeDelMap (#4424)Nikhil Benesch
2018-09-18Unit test for custom comparator RangeDelAggregator (#4388)Andrew Kryczka
2018-09-18use specified comparator in CollapsedRangeDelMap (#4386)jsteemann
2018-09-10Restrict RangeDelAggregator's tombstone end-key truncation (#4356)Abhishek Madan
2018-09-06Fix a lint error due to unspecified move evaluation order (#4348)Anand Ananthabhotla
2018-08-31Reduce empty SST creation/deletion in compaction (#4336)Andrew Kryczka
2018-08-23Add path to WritableFileWriter. (#4039)Yanqin Jin
2018-08-14fix compilation with g++ option `-Wsuggest-override` (#4272)jsteemann
2018-08-09Add SST ingestion to ldb (#4205)Yanqin Jin
2018-08-01Skip range deletions at seqno zero when collapsing (#4216)Andrew Kryczka
2018-07-13Support range deletion tombstones in IngestExternalFile SSTs (#3778)Nathan VanBenschoten
2018-07-13Relax VersionStorageInfo::GetOverlappingInputs check (#4050)Peter Mattis
2018-07-12Range deletion performance improvements + cleanup (#4014)Nikhil Benesch
2018-05-21Assert keys/values pinned by range deletion meta-block iteratorsAndrew Kryczka
2018-05-04Recommit "Avoid adding tombstones of the same file to RangeDelAggregator mult...LingBin
2018-04-02Revert "Avoid adding tombstones of the same file to RangeDelAggregato…Zhongyi Xie
2018-03-23Avoid adding tombstones of the same file to RangeDelAggregator multiple timesLingBin
2017-11-28optimize file ingestion checks for range deletion overlapAndrew Kryczka
2017-09-14Two small refactoring for better inliningSiying Dong
2017-08-29Fix wrong smallest key of delete range tombstonesHuachao Huang
2017-08-29avoid use-after-move errorAndrew Kryczka
2017-07-15Change RocksDB LicenseSiying Dong
2017-04-27Add GPLv2 as an alternative license.Siying Dong
2017-01-25Fix DeleteRange including sentinels in output filesAndrew Kryczka
2017-01-05Maintain position in range deletions mapAndrew Kryczka
2016-12-19Collapse range deletionsAndrew Kryczka
2016-11-28DeleteRange compaction statisticsAndrew Kryczka
2016-11-19Remove Arena in RangeDelAggregatorAndrew Kryczka
2016-11-18Lazily initialize RangeDelAggregator's map and pinning managerAndrew Kryczka
2016-11-14Consider subcompaction boundaries when updating file boundaries for range del...Andrew Kryczka
2016-11-14Make range deletion inclusive-exclusiveAndrew Kryczka
2016-11-09Store internal keys in TombstoneMapAndrew Kryczka
2016-11-04DeleteRange user iterator supportAndrew Kryczka
2016-11-03DeleteRange Get supportAndrew Kryczka
2016-10-19Fix uninitialized variable gcc error for MyRocksAndrew Kryczka
2016-10-18Compaction Support for Range DeletionAndrew Kryczka